Transformative Technologies Powering the Future of UK Businesses
Exploring core innovations driving change
High-tech computing in the UK increasingly relies on a combination of artificial intelligence, cloud computing, and emerging fields like quantum computing. These technologies form the backbone of digital transformation efforts across a broad range of sectors. AI algorithms automate decision-making and customer service, while cloud platforms offer scalable, cost-effective infrastructure for data-intensive operations.
Quantum computing, though still in nascent stages, promises to revolutionize problem-solving capabilities with its potential for exponentially faster processing speeds in tasks like complex modelling and cryptography. Meanwhile, the Internet of Things (IoT) and edge computing extend computing power closer to data sources, allowing real-time analytics and responsiveness—critical for UK manufacturing and logistics competitiveness.
UK businesses are demonstrating robust adoption trends. Financial services utilize AI for enhanced fraud detection, energy companies optimize grids using IoT, and healthcare providers embrace cloud computing for patient data management and telemedicine. This adoption is steadily reshaping traditional sectors by improving operational agility and enabling innovation.
Experts underscore that the synergy of these technologies—rather than any single one—is key to driving sustained business transformation and maintaining the UK’s competitive edge on the global stage.
